Summary

In this episode of We Love Our Team, hosts Jack and Randy welcome award-winning author Michelle Houts, who shares her journey from a special educator to a successful children's book author. 

The conversation delves into her latest book, 'Kammie on First,' which tells the inspiring story of Dottie Kamenchek, a trailblazer in women's baseball during the All-American Girls Professional Baseball League. Michelle discusses the evolution of the league, the impact of the film 'A League of Their Own,' and Dottie's legacy. 

The episode also touches on Michelle's writing process and her current projects, making it a rich exploration of storytelling, baseball, and the importance of representation in literature.

Takeaways

  • Michelle Houts transitioned from education to writing children's books.
  • Her inspiration for writing came from reading with her children.
  • Dottie Kamenshek was a significant figure in women's baseball history.
  • The All-American Girls Professional Baseball League evolved from softball to baseball.
  • The film 'A League of Their Own' accurately portrayed many aspects of the league.
  • Dottie Kamenshek's story is an important part of Cincinnati's history.
  • Michelle emphasizes the importance of engaging stories for all readers.
  • The league's players were paid more than many factory jobs during the war.
  • Dottie's legacy continues to inspire new generations of athletes.
  • Michelle is currently working on a middle-grade fiction series.
